1965 Stockton Ports Roster

California League (CL) - Class: A
Team Record: 83-57
Finished 1st in the CL
Manager: Harry Malmberg (83-57)
Affiliation: Baltimore Orioles
Location: Stockton, California
Ballpark: Billy Hebert Field
Attendance: 27,774, Avg. 397
1965 Stockton Ports Statistics

Playoffs - Stockton Ports 2 games, San Jose Bees 0

The Stockton Ports of the California League ended the 1965 season with a record of 83 wins and 57 losses, finishing first in the CL.

Harry Malmberg served as manager.
